    Frequently Asked Questions About the Best Restaurants in Florence

    What type of cuisine is Florence known for?

    Florence is renowned for its traditional Tuscan cuisine, which features hearty dishes made with fresh, local ingredients. Expect to find plenty of pasta, meat dishes like bistecca alla Fiorentina (Florentine steak), and flavorful sauces. (See Also: Best Restaurant In Quad Cities)

    Where can I find the best pizza in Florence?

    While Florence is famous for its other culinary delights, you can still find excellent pizza. Look for pizzerias in the Oltrarno neighborhood, known for its authentic and traditional offerings.

    Are there any Michelin-starred restaurants in Florence?

    Yes, Florence boasts several Michelin-starred restaurants, offering exquisite dining experiences. These establishments showcase innovative culinary techniques and exceptional ingredients.

    What is a good budget-friendly option for dining in Florence?

    Florence has plenty of affordable trattorias and osterias where you can enjoy delicious, authentic Tuscan food at reasonable prices. Explore the Oltrarno and San Lorenzo neighborhoods for great value meals.

    What are some popular Florentine dishes I should try?

    Be sure to sample classic dishes like ribollita (bread and vegetable soup), lampredotto (tripe sandwich), and pappa al pomodoro (bread and tomato soup). For dessert, indulge in cantucci (almond biscuits) and vin santo (sweet dessert wine).
